Helein, Frédéric Inégalité isopérimétrique et calibration. (Isoperimetric inequality and calibration). (French) Zbl 0830.49029 Ann. Inst. Fourier 44, No. 4, 1211-1218 (1994). Summary: We show that the isoperimetric inequality for a domain in the Euclidean plane, the two-dimensional sphere, or the two-dimensional hyperbolic space, may be obtained using a calibration.
